Historical Context

Social movements have a long history of shaping societies and bringing about significant change. From the civil rights movement of the 1960s to the women’s suffrage movement of the early 20th century, individuals have played a crucial role in driving these movements forward. These movements have paved the way for progress in areas such as civil rights, gender equality, and environmental protection.

Current State

Today, we are witnessing a new wave of social movements led by individuals who are leveraging technology and social media to amplify their voices and reach a wider audience. Movements like #BlackLivesMatter and #MeToo have gained traction on social media platforms, sparking national and international conversations about race, gender, and equality. These movements have mobilized individuals from diverse backgrounds to come together and demand change.
